Mississippi at a glance
| Figure | Mississippi | Source |
|---|---|---|
| State transfer tax rate | None | [2] |
| Attorney required at closing | Yes | [2] |
| Typical total closing cost | 2.60% | [2] |
| On the median home | $5,148 | [1] |

Mississippi closing costs by price and side
Buyer and seller totals (no state transfer tax applies).
| Purchase price | Buyer total | Seller total | Transfer tax |
|---|---|---|---|
| $100,000 | $2,750 | $2,050 | $0 |
| $150,000 | $3,450 | $2,400 | $0 |
| $175,000 | $3,800 | $2,575 | $0 |
| $200,000 | $4,150 | $2,750 | $0 |
| $225,000 | $4,500 | $2,925 | $0 |
| $250,000 | $4,850 | $3,100 | $0 |
| $300,000 | $5,550 | $3,450 | $0 |
| $350,000 | $6,250 | $3,800 | $0 |
| $400,000 | $6,950 | $4,150 | $0 |
| $450,000 | $7,650 | $4,500 | $0 |
| $500,000 | $8,350 | $4,850 | $0 |
| $600,000 | $9,750 | $5,550 | $0 |
| $700,000 | $11,150 | $6,250 | $0 |
| $800,000 | $12,550 | $6,950 | $0 |
| $950,000 | $14,650 | $8,000 | $0 |
| $1,100,000 | $16,750 | $9,050 | $0 |
| $1,300,000 | $19,550 | $10,450 | $0 |
| $1,600,000 | $23,750 | $12,550 | $0 |

How Mississippi compares nationally
On typical closing cost, Mississippi ranks #28 of 50 at 2.60% — 4% below the median of 2.70%. The national range runs from 2.00% (California) to 3.80% (New York).
| Rank | State | Typical closing cost |
|---|---|---|
| #26 | Virginia | 2.70% |
| #27 | Kansas | 2.60% |
| #28 | Mississippi | 2.60% |
| #29 | South Dakota | 2.60% |
| #30 | Tennessee | 2.60% |
